Guy Walton has been the head coach of the Virginia Union University men's and women's tennis teams since 2000. As head coach, Walton is responsible for the daily operations of the VUU tennis teams.
During his tenure at Virginia Union, Walton's men's tennis team was earned highest Grade Point Average in the Central Intercollegiate Athletic Association (CIAA) in 2010-11.
In 2011 Walton was named the United State Tennis Association Mid-Atlantic/Virginia Collegiate Coach of the Year.
In 2003-04, both the men's and women's tennis teams earned the Highest Grade Point Award at VUU.
In 2012 Walton received his USTA high performance certification.
In 2011 and in 2012, Walton was named a Zonal Coach by the USTA.
Walton has been a tennis instructor for the City of Richmond Department of Parks and Recreation since 2001.
